Russian foreign minister says denuclearization of N.Korea meaningless Russia’s foreign minister says the term denuclearization when applied to North Korea is meaningless in light of what he described as a serious regional security threat posed by the United States, South Korea and Japan.

Sergey Lavrov also accused them of openly calling the US-South Korea alliance a “nuclear alliance” like NATO.

The comments were posted online on Thursday.

Lavrov said the United States and South Korea are attempting to form a tripartite with Japan, and accused Tokyo of being “outspoken in its commitment to remilitarisation.”

Lavrov said denuclearization under such conditions is “off the table.”

Russia has strengthened ties with North Korea since invading Ukraine. In June, Moscow and Pyongyang signed a treaty pledging mutual military assistance in a contingency.
